Factors to Consider When Choosing a Dye
When selecting a professional-grade dye for PVC, here are the key factors I considered:
- Color Fastness: I always checked the dye’s resistance to fading over time, especially for outdoor applications. A dye that can withstand UV exposure and environmental conditions is crucial.
- Ease of Application: I preferred dyes that came with clear instructions and were easy to apply. The last thing I wanted was a complicated process that could lead to unsatisfactory results.
- Safety and Environmental Impact: As someone who cares about safety, I looked for non-toxic dyes and those with low VOC (volatile organic compounds) to minimize harmful emissions during application.
- Cost: I found that while some professional-grade dyes can be pricey, investing in quality often meant better results and less waste in the long run.
Application Tips for Best Results
Based on my experiences, here are some tips for applying professional-grade color dyes to PVC:
- Preparation is Key: I always made sure to clean the PVC surface thoroughly before applying dye. Any dirt or grease can prevent the dye from adhering properly.
- Test First: I conducted a small test on an inconspicuous area to see how the color turned out before committing to the entire project.
- Use Proper Tools: Depending on the dye type, I used brushes, sponges, or spray equipment to achieve an even application.
- Follow Drying Times: I paid close attention to the recommended drying times to ensure a durable finish. Rushing this step can lead to smudges or uneven coloring.
